Sruthi Ranjani, who was born on September 15, 1993, in Vijaynagar, Andhra Pradesh, India, is an eminent singer and a playback singer. Her father, Mr. Sri Modumudi Sudhakar, is a classical musician, and her mother, Mrs. Anjana Sudhakar, is a Carnatic vocalist, which is the prominent reason for her acknowledgment of the art of music at a very young age. She was just 4 years old when she gave her first stage performance, and from there until now, she has made around 400+ classical concerts. Whether as a playback singer in Telugu and Tamil or a performer on stages such as Naada Neerajanam, Swara Samara, or more, she slayed in every scenario.
She completed her schooling at Nirmala High School in Vijayawada and then completed her graduation in Bachelor of Technology in Biotechnology, and after that, she joined Fashion Technology. Additionally, she has also pursued a diploma in Carnatic music. She started her career on her YouTube channel, where her devotional song “Garuda Gamana” gained a lot of popularity. Along with singing, she also carries a good knowledge of composing music and writing lyrics, as she showed in her song “Naa Kamulake.” From YouTube, she carried her essence as a performer to different programs on TV channels, where she got recognition from music directors and sang in many movies like ‘Merise Merise’ from Hello (2017), ‘Om Namashivaya’ from A Journey to Kashi (2022), and her newest, ‘The Soul of Satya’ from the movie Satya (2023).
